INTELSAT 23 will replace Intelsat 707, an aging satellite launched in 1996. The new satellite carries 15 active Ku-band and 24 active C-band transponders, and from a position at 53 degrees west longitude in geostationary, the craft will reach customers in the Americas, the Caribbean, Western Europe, Africa, and islands in the Atlantic and Pacific. Built by Orbital Sciences Corp. of Dulles, Va., Intelsat 23 is designed for a lifetime of more than 18 years, according to Intelsat of Luxembourg, the world's largest communications satellite operator.
